8 times 9 - 7 + 4 times 5
Use PEMDAS. Parentheses, Exponent, Multiply, Divide, Add, Subtract
Multiply:
8 times 9 = 72
4 times 5 = 20
72 - 7 + 20
Add:
72 + 20 = 92
Subtract:
92 - 7 = 85
8 times 9 - 7 + 4 times 5 is equal to 85.
